Output 23060eb06618daafbd34e2abf3a6ad838698d64d8d6c9001fcaaa6abc730b5d6:0

value
2046700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43de04ff30717c954fcf572ed372009adc1636c9 OP_EQUAL
address
37ssAamUWJpRq6BJbLQMDXXDrWLGV1548W
transaction
23060eb06618daafbd34e2abf3a6ad838698d64d8d6c9001fcaaa6abc730b5d6
spent
true